TRENDS & DISRUPTIONS IMPACTING CUSTOMERS' CUSTOMERS

Trends in the aquafeed market are increasingly driven by the incorporation of functional additives and amino acids. These ingredients enhance the nutritional profile of aquafeed, leading to improved growth rates and feed conversion efficiency in aquatic species. Additives like probiotics, prebiotics, and enzymes boost gut health and disease resistance, while essential amino acids support optimal protein synthesis and overall health. This advancement supports more sustainable and productive aquaculture operations.

Avanti Feeds Limited recognized the need for a robust domestic aquafeed manufacturing ecosystem. It focused on building strong collaborations with East Asian countries like Taiwan and Thailand, leveraging their expertise in machinery and raw materials. Avanti Feeds Limited's strategic initiatives led to transformative outcomes in the Indian aquafeed industry. By collaborating with East Asian countries, it secured reliable access to machinery and raw materials, reducing dependence on imports.
ADM developed Aquatrax, a specialty feed ingredient based on Pichia guilliermondii, a novel yeast with unique bioactive cell wall components. The addition of Pichia guilliermondii led to significant gains in shrimp body weight, reflecting improved growth performance and productivity.
BioMar introduced a new functional feed designed to enhance the resilience of seabass against bacterial infections during vulnerable production periods. The formulation aims to improve fish health and reduce mortality linked to bacterial stressors in farmed seabass. It contributes to better survivability and performance during high-risk bacterial challenge phases in aquaculture operations.

Aquafeed Market, By Igredient

Fishmeal has the capability to improve the overall efficiency of the feed and enhance the growth, palatability, nutrition uptake, digestion, and absorption of aquatic species.

Aquafeed Market, By Form

Dry feeds are mainly predominant due to the facility and convenience they provide over the other forms.

Aquafeed Market, By Species

The aquaculture industry includes a diverse range of fish species, each with its specific feed requirements. Different species have different nutritional needs, growth rates, and feed preferences. Therefore, a variety of specialized fish feeds are developed to cater to the specific requirements of various fish species, contributing to the value of the fish segment.

Aquafeed Market, By Lifecycle

Grower aquafeed meets the demand of aquatic species, switching to a more developed growth stage, normally containing 30–40% protein, which supports the continuity of development but synchronizes growth at reduced rates.

RECENT DEVELOPMENTS IN THE AQUAFEED INDUSTRY

  • February 2026: BioMar launched a new functional seabass feed solution designed to support Mediterranean seabass health and reduce mortality from bacterial infections.
  • October 2025: Skretting introduced a next-generation range of its global shrimp feeds, Lorica and Optiline, featuring new EDGEOS PhytoComplexes to boost shrimp health, resilience, growth performance, and feed efficiency, while enhancing sustainability.
  • December 2024: Aller Aqua Group partnered with AquaRech to improve access to high-quality fish feeds for fish farmers across Kenya. This collaboration combines Aller Aqua’s expertise in premium feed production with AquaRech’s extensive Last Mile Distribution System, ensuring consistent supply and accessibility in key regions
